Rahul Sipligunj meets Rihanna at the Oscars

Rahul Sipligunj, who recently performed the Oscar award-winning Naatu Naatu at the Academy Awards ceremony, met his fellow nominee and global pop star Rihanna. Rihanna was nominated in the Best Original Song category for the single Lift Me Up from the film Black Panther: Wakanda Forever. Rihanna, incidentally also performed her song at the awards show, which took place on Sunday night.

Taking to social media to express his excitement at meeting the Barbadian singer, Rahul wrote, "Wow! Met an most amazing lady with a very beautiful heart. Still in shock by seeing your humbleness Rihanna and how down to earth you are! Thank you so much for calling and appreciating for the performance and our Oscar win. It’s an emotional moment for me! A dream come true."

In addition to singing, Rahul Sipligunj will soon be making his acting debut with Krishna Vamsi's upcoming film Rangamarthanda, where he will be starring opposite Shivatmika Rajashekar. Rangamarthanda is the official Telugu adaptation of the Marathi film Natsamrat (2016) and stars Brahmanandam, Prakash Raj and Ramya Krishnan in principal roles.
